Output 54a77096c420009d4b692e668664bc05cb33b4c14cff6cf6b0fbf5f4da06a32a:1

value
2053813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63f021d3a0a78dba7b668167f76f2756308c250 OP_EQUAL
address
3MDr1V9CHxdsGnNFUifdc9HzarxwtsPrVX
transaction
54a77096c420009d4b692e668664bc05cb33b4c14cff6cf6b0fbf5f4da06a32a
spent
true